Pittsburgh, September 26: US President Barack Obama today underlined that the stability in Afghanistan and Pakistan is critical to the American mission of defeating the al-Qaeda and the Taliban in the region.
Obama said his overriding goal is to dismantle the al-Qaeda network, to destroy their capacity to inflict harm not just on the US, but people of all faiths and all nationalities all around the world.
“Stability in Afghanistan and in Pakistan are critical to that mission,” the President told mediapersons at the end of the G-20 Summit in Pittsburgh.
He said after several years of drift in Afghanistan, “we now find ourselves in a situation in which you have strong commitments from the ISAF coalition, our NATO allies, all of them are committed to making this work”.
